## Break-Glass Access — Pinfield Autocomplete Widget

Maintainers: if the Pinfield address-autocomplete widget fails closed and blocks checkout, use break-glass access to disable the suggestion service and fall back to plain text entry. Requires two-person sign-off in the Ledgerstone console. Log the incident within one hour. Break-glass authentication prompts for the recovery passphrase shown below.

unlock words, hahip-baduf: holwyn-istath-julvan

Subject: New owner for query planner regression work

Hello plugin authors,

The regression introduced in Bramblecore 4.2, where certain joined queries fall back to sequential scans, is being reassigned following a team reorganization. A patched planner build is targeted for the 4.2.3 release; until then, the documented hint workaround remains supported. Please tag regression reports with the planner label so they route correctly. Ownership now sits with the engineer named below.

approver of yajef-fajef = Oliwyn Silion Kasok Kasox

**14:22 — Snapshot suite goes red across the board**

After the Brindle UI kit bump, basically every component snapshot failed at once — not a real regression, just a font-metrics change shifting pixel baselines. Support heads-up: any tickets about "broken buttons" from this window are false alarms. We re-baselined by 15:05. The offending build is tagged with the token below.

pipeline stamp: htk9_ce63042d9

**Ticket: Feed validator rejecting Harkwell episodes**

The Plumecast feed validator is failing signature checks on all Harkwell Audio uploads since Tuesday's deploy. Verified the feed XML is intact; the failure is in envelope verification, not content. Likely cause: the validator is still pinned to the retired key. Please update it to the current signing key below.

release key, hadug-kawef: bky13_mPGeFZeR1GZ1G